Across TCGA pan-cancer cohorts, RPL37A-DT RNA differs between tumor and matched normal tissue in 11 of 18 cancer types tested, making tumor–normal expression one of RPL37A-DT’s most consistent transcriptional readouts.
The strongest signal is observed in kidney chromophobe (KICH), where RPL37A-DT RNA is repressed in tumor relative to normal tissue. In most cancer types RPL37A-DT is over-expressed in tumor, although a few such as KICH and THCA show the opposite, repressed pattern.
KICH, THCA, and HNSC are the cancer types where RPL37A-DT tumor–normal differential expression is most reproducible.
